#company_r {
	 MARGIN:30px 0px 0px 70px;
}
#company_r2{
	 MARGIN:20px 0px 0px 80px;background:#fff;
}
#recruit_head {
MARGIN:20px 0px 0px 170px;
}
	.koumoku_ttl{
font-size:13px;color:#333;font-weight:bold;padding:8px 15px 12px 6px;text-align:left;
}	
		
.koumoku{
font-size:12px;color:#660000;font-weight:bold;padding:8px 15px 12px 6px;text-align:left;
}
.naiyou{
font-size:13px;color:#555;line-height:16px;padding:9px 0px 15px 0px;text-align:left;
}
.naiyou .btn{
padding:15px 0px 0px 15px;
}
.naiyou td{
font-size:13px;color:#555;text-align:left;padding:0px 3px;
}
.line{
padding:0px;background-color:#999;
}
.recttl
{font:16px color:#000000;
	font-weight:bold;
	text-align:left;
	padding-top: 8px;
	padding-right: 0px;
	padding-bottom: 12px;
	padding-left: 0px;
}

.pdflink {padding:5px 0px 15px 0px;}

.naiyou A:link,.pdflink A:link {
	COLOR: #000066; TEXT-DECORATION: underline;font-size:12px;
}
.naiyou A:visited,.pdflink A:visited  {
	COLOR: #000066; TEXT-DECORATION: underline;font-size:12px;
}
.naiyou A:hover,.pdflink A:hover  {
	COLOR: #C9B89E; TEXT-DECORATION: underline;font-size:12px;
}
.b_entry{padding:10px ;background-color:#dedede;}

.prp, .prp2 {margin-top:5px; font-size:83%;}
.prp a{color:#FFFFFF; font-size:83%;}
.prp2 a{color:#666666; font-size:83%;}